Interesting Facts About the Daewoo Evanda V200

The Daewoo Evanda V200 was produced from 2000 to 2006 and was sold under several different brand names around the world. It is a 4‑door sedan that seats five passengers and runs on petrol.

Production Span and Generation

The Evanda V200 was introduced in the year 2000 and remained in production until 2006, covering multiple model years such as 2002‑2004 and 2004‑2006 according to various catalogues.

Multiple Market Names

During its lifespan the Evanda V200 was marketed not only as a Daewoo but also as the Chevrolet Epica/Evanda, Suzuki Verona, and Formosa Magnus, reflecting its global badge engineering strategy.

Body Style and Engine

The V200 is a 4‑door sedan with five seats, powered by a petrol engine; some owners note that it uses a 2.2‑liter engine.
